Abstract
In the existing methods, the vulnerability mining is randomly generating the structural information of the model according to application model, generating easily a large number of low-quality test cases, and seriously affecting the efficiency and effect of vulnerability mining. To solve this problem, a vulnerability mining method of deep learning framework was proposed based on a guiding model generation method with reinforcement learning. Firstly, frame state information during model running was extracted, including Softmax distance and program execution results, etc. Then the extracted frame running state information was taken as a reward variable to guide the generation of model structure and hyper-parameters, so as to improve the quality and efficiency of test case generation. Experimental results show that this method can find more vulnerability of deep learning frameworks under the same number of generated test cases, possessing high practical value.
Translated title of the contribution | Vulnerability Mining of Deep Learning Framework for Model Generation Guided by Reinforcement Learning |
---|---|
Original language | Chinese (Traditional) |
Pages (from-to) | 521-529 |
Number of pages | 9 |
Journal | Beijing Ligong Daxue Xuebao/Transaction of Beijing Institute of Technology |
Volume | 44 |
Issue number | 5 |
DOIs | |
Publication status | Published - May 2024 |